 +==== Packages ====
 +
 +[Among the 4400 packages available in SliTaz 5.0 you will find anything you need to transform your machine to an
 +office suite with LibreOffice,​ graphics studio with The Gimp or Inkscape, a video editor with Kino or a complete graphical desktop (razor-qt),​. You can experience the world wide web with instant messaging, VOIP, email and of course through a web browser. Packages can be found through the search function of Tazpkg, Tazpanel or via the website: http://​pkgs.slitaz.org/​

 +Iptables functions as the firewall and Rsync can be installed for incremental backup. SliTaz can of course also provide a complete development environment with the GCC 4.6.3 compiler, Geany IDE, Mercurial Repostitories and all development libraries.
 +
 +SliTaz is designed to function as a powerful web server, using the stable LightTPD/​PHP package (not installed by default), supporting CGI, Perl and Python. Apache, Squid and Privoxy are also available. The ability to browse the web securely using the Tor network is also supported. Packages are also checked by Cookutils to ensure the FHS is followed and packages are now built automatically by the SliTaz Build Bot: http://​cook.slitaz.org/​ ]

 +==== Administration ====
 +
 +The tool to configure the system on SliTaz 5.0 is TazPanel. It is a CGI/web interface with a themable user interface - which was updated for 5.0 - from where you can control your entire system such as networking, package management, adding or removing users, managing hardware, creating Live systems and much more. Each page provides a small description to help you manage your SliTaz system. To access the panel you can use the menu entry in “System Tools” or this url: http://​tazpanel:​82 ​
